Output ddf4cebea31dd582ba182de927aa0083a8b6856bb67b7770eb632243c4059d0b:3

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4ca09b306ddb4d08894cf7ce45091a0ece58ced OP_EQUAL
address
3Q1LqBupmNW3R6oC4Q59yhKVnXrd1cE7tW
transaction
ddf4cebea31dd582ba182de927aa0083a8b6856bb67b7770eb632243c4059d0b
confirmations
184915
spent
true